About this business

CERTIFIED ORGANIC COFFEE ROASTER SPECIALIZING IN 100% FAIR TRADE COFFEE Grounds for Change roasts Fair Trade Coffee and Organic Coffee that is CarbonFree Certified. Our Coffee of the Month Club is the perfect coffee gift for any occasion and we have a comprehensive Wholesale Coffee Program for independent cafes, as well as a Coffee Fundraiser for organizations. Every single bean we roast is certified fair trade, organic, and carbon-free.
